Transaction 17d28ccb9944633aed870a167208c4f1e8d0120261466b118a94b29e32ab7146

1 Input
2 Outputs
  • 17d28ccb9944633aed870a167208c4f1e8d0120261466b118a94b29e32ab7146:0
  • value  26572
    address  1D7a1jU8EPaA1eWW3GxmN5RtJjzdYCRdgM
  • 17d28ccb9944633aed870a167208c4f1e8d0120261466b118a94b29e32ab7146:1
  • value  8480879
    address  3ERUfCazgR37MunvDgLFgTbwHphAcsXzS2